Output 8a8fbbe38e956c0243059931d164c1f6ec8aac1ea0b8ac76fed5e6eb209b5d07: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 819bd1b619df7a534883486293bc73912bf8addc OP_EQUAL
address
3DWKkoAAnEg84TF9VEvV9hbenDBesyixEA
transaction
8a8fbbe38e956c0243059931d164c1f6ec8aac1ea0b8ac76fed5e6eb209b5d07
confirmations
378340
spent
true